The global Piezoelectric Nanoprobe Station market is projected to grow from US$ 1047 million in 2025 to US$ 1233 million by 2032, at a CAGR of 2.4% (2026-2032), driven by critical product segments and diverse end‑use applications, while evolving U.S. tariff policies introduce trade‑cost volatility and supply‑chain uncertainty.

The main function of the piezoelectric nanoprobe station is to complete nanoscale physical property measurements and nanoscale motion operations. It can achieve precise positioning in three-dimensional space.

The piezoelectric nanoprobe station has the characteristics of high motion resolution, high positioning accuracy, large motion range, wide operating temperature range, good flexibility, small size, low energy consumption, and high stability. These characteristics make the piezoelectric nanoprobe station have broad application prospects in the fields of material science, life science, etc. At the same time, it can also be used in a vacuum environment, meeting the needs of certain special experimental conditions. At present, my country has been able to independently develop and produce piezoelectric nanoprobe stations, and has achieved remarkable results in some fields. In the future, with the continuous advancement of technology and the continuous expansion of application fields, the market prospects of piezoelectric nanoprobe stations will be broader.
